Aspects of carbon monoxide production and oxidation by marine macroalgae
Rates of macroalgal carbon monoxide (CO) production were compared among 5 taxa representing 3 major phylogenetic groups (Phaeophyta, Chlorophyta, Rhodophyta). CO production varied substantially from a minimum of about 20 ng CO gdw–1 h–1 for Fucus vesiculosus to >4000 ng CO gdw–1 h–1 for Laminaria saccharina. متن کاملC3 and C4 pathways of photosynthetic carbon assimilation in marine diatoms are under genetic, not environmental, control.
Marine diatoms are responsible for up to 20% of global CO(2) fixation. Their photosynthetic efficiency is enhanced by concentrating CO(2) around Rubisco, diminishing photorespiration, but the mechanism is yet to be resolved.
